Transaction 7117b229a26ea595f7817002cd299f0a8ef177a82143da89de87cebc447bee24

3 Input
2 Outputs
  • 7117b229a26ea595f7817002cd299f0a8ef177a82143da89de87cebc447bee24:0
  • value  160000000
    address  1Hs2zDJ8jhMYguL7VQ7FNSB8x7em5JwJuT
  • 7117b229a26ea595f7817002cd299f0a8ef177a82143da89de87cebc447bee24:1
  • value  49593028
    address  1MFcYCzoNXa5FbV1TUhY3Wuy8g2W2Zz5H3